3. Wind Situations
Wind circumstances are a big determinant of flight time between Dallas and Los Angeles. Primarily, jet streams, high-altitude air currents, exert a substantial affect. When an plane flies eastbound, a tailwind supplied by the jet stream will increase floor pace, thereby lowering flight length. Conversely, a westbound flight encounters a headwind, reducing floor pace and growing flight time. The magnitude of this impact is straight proportional to the wind’s velocity; stronger winds lead to extra pronounced modifications to the flight time. For instance, a constant 50-knot tailwind can shave roughly 20-Half-hour off the eastbound flight, whereas an analogous headwind provides a comparable quantity to the westbound flight.
Airways meticulously analyze wind forecasts to optimize flight plans and gas consumption. Dispatchers choose routes that leverage favorable wind patterns and keep away from unfavorable ones. Regardless of these efforts, wind circumstances stay inherently variable and may change considerably throughout a flight, necessitating changes in altitude or route. The affect of wind is especially noticeable on long-haul flights; nevertheless, even on a route like Dallas to Los Angeles, which is taken into account medium-haul, the cumulative impact of constant headwinds or tailwinds considerably influences arrival instances. Flight durations printed by airways account for common wind circumstances, however passengers ought to acknowledge that precise flight instances can deviate considerably resulting from these atmospheric dynamics.

5. Routing
Flight routing, the particular path an plane follows between departure and arrival, considerably impacts the length of flights between Dallas and Los Angeles. The chosen route isn’t a straight line resulting from varied constraints and concerns.
-
Commonplace Instrument Departures (SIDs) and Commonplace Terminal Arrival Routes (STARs)
These pre-defined routes are used close to airports to make sure secure and environment friendly transitions between terminal airspace and en-route airspace. SIDs dictate the trail an plane follows after takeoff, whereas STARs information plane throughout strategy and touchdown. Utilization of SIDs and STARs might add distance to the flight in comparison with a direct route, growing the length, however they improve security and cut back air visitors controller workload. These are necessary procedures, and subsequently affect the general flight time.
-
Air Visitors Management Directives
Air Visitors Management (ATC) might instruct pilots to deviate from deliberate routes to handle visitors movement, keep away from inclement climate, or keep separation between plane. These deviations, also known as “vectors,” add distance to the flight and enhance the general length. ATC directives can change dynamically throughout flight, requiring pilots to regulate their course accordingly. This leads to unpredictable variations to the deliberate route and in the end, the flight time.
-
Airway System
Outdoors of terminal areas, plane usually fly alongside designated airways, that are like highways within the sky. These airways are outlined by navigational aids and symbolize established routes between cities. Whereas following airways ensures constant navigation and airspace administration, the airway system itself might not present essentially the most direct path between Dallas and Los Angeles. The requirement to stick to the airway system influences flight time by prescribing probably longer routes. This technique is integral to secure and controlled air journey.
-
Jet Stream Utilization
As talked about beforehand, jet streams considerably affect flight time. Flight routes are sometimes deliberate to benefit from favorable jet stream circumstances, notably on eastbound flights. To leverage a tailwind, the plane might fly a route that deviates from essentially the most direct path, however the elevated floor pace as a result of wind in the end reduces the general journey time. Conversely, routes are deliberate to attenuate publicity to headwinds, probably including distance to the flight however lowering the online impact of the wind on flight time. This demonstrates how strategic route planning can decrease total flight time.

Regularly Requested Questions
The next questions tackle frequent inquiries regarding air journey length between Dallas, Texas, and Los Angeles, California. These solutions intention to supply readability and detailed info relating to varied elements that affect this length.
Query 1: What’s the common length of flights from Dallas to Los Angeles?
The nominal length is roughly 3 hours and Half-hour to 4 hours. This estimate represents a typical direct flight below normal circumstances. Nevertheless, precise flight instances might range resulting from elements mentioned in different questions.
Query 2: Why do flight instances range between totally different airways on the Dallas to Los Angeles route?
Variations come up resulting from variations in plane kind, routing methods, and scheduling practices. Airways might make the most of totally different plane fashions with various cruising speeds. Additionally they might choose routes that optimize for gas effectivity or decrease potential delays, resulting in variations within the time required to finish the journey.
Query 3: How do headwinds and tailwinds have an effect on the flight time from Dallas to Los Angeles?
Headwinds, encountered on westbound flights, cut back the plane’s floor pace, growing the length. Tailwinds, frequent on eastbound flights, enhance floor pace, shortening the length. The magnitude of those results depends upon wind velocity, which fluctuates all year long.
Query 4: What affect do airport congestion and air visitors management have on the flight time?
Excessive visitors quantity and congestion necessitate elevated spacing between plane, probably resulting in delays in departure, en-route diversions, and prolonged holding patterns. Air visitors management might implement measures to mitigate congestion, akin to floor stops and rerouting, additional affecting the precise length.
Query 5: How does climate have an effect on flight length on the Dallas to Los Angeles route?
Antagonistic climate, together with thunderstorms, heavy rain, snow, and powerful winds, can necessitate deviations from deliberate routes, resulting in elevated distance and flight time. Climate circumstances on the origin, vacation spot, or alongside the route might also lead to floor delays or airport closures.
Query 6: Is there a noticeable distinction in flight time primarily based on the time of day the flight departs?
Flights departing throughout peak hours are statistically extra more likely to encounter delays resulting from elevated air visitors congestion. Flights scheduled throughout off-peak hours usually expertise fewer delays and should obtain a more in-depth approximation to the nominal flight time.
